public void Test_dataCutQuirkyBeacon_FilterSmallMode() { // Arrange dataCutQuirkyBeacon d = new dataCutQuirkyBeacon(17); int[] testArray = new int[6] { 23, 28, 4, 20, 5, 58 }; int[] assertArray = new int[1] { 5 }; // Act d.scramble(testArray); int[] dFilter = d.filter(); // Assert CollectionAssert.AreEqual(dFilter, assertArray); }
public void Test_dataCutQuirkyBeacon_FilterLargeMode() { // Arrange dataCutQuirkyBeacon d = new dataCutQuirkyBeacon(19); d.setMode(true); int[] testArray = new int[6] { 23, 28, 4, 20, 5, 58 }; int[] assertArray = new int[3] { 23, 28, 20 }; // Act d.scramble(testArray); int[] dFilter = d.filter(); // Assert CollectionAssert.AreEqual(dFilter, assertArray); }